Abstract
Direct formic acid fuel cells (DFAFCs) MEAs were fabricated by using Pt black and Pt/C as cathode catalysts, with various amount of Nafion ionomer. The effect of ionomer content on oxygen reduction reaction (ORR) activities was examined by single cell test, and the MEAs were electrochemically characterized by cyclic voltammetry (CV) and electrochemical impedance spectroscopy (EIS). Especially the ionic resistances of cathode layers were measured by the complex capacitance analysis of experimental impedance data. The influence of charge transfer reaction on Pt and mass transport of proton and oxygen in the catalyst layers (CL) were discussed for the DFAFC MEAs based on Pt black and Pt/C catalysts.
